Blair Cadell are delighted to bring to market this well presented semi-detached bungalow in the popular village of Newtongrange. With three double bedrooms, superb local amenities and easy access to the capital, the property would be perfect for a range of buyers and must be viewed. The accomodation comprises of a large living room perfect for relaxing with friends and family. Kitchen is fitted with a range of floor and wall mounted units, gas hob and electric oven, integrated fridge/freezer and white goods which are available by separate negotiation. A large dining room to the rear of the property which offers direct access to the back garden. There are three double bedrooms with the master featuring a lovely bay window. A family bathroom fitted with a three-piece suite and mains shower over the bath featuring a fantastic rainwater shower head. The hallway offers access to a partially floored attic. There is gas central heating and double glazing throughout for maximum efficiency. Private back garden which has a useful shelter for bikes along with outdoor store for garden tools. Off-street parking available via a driveway at the front of the property. Newtongrange is located to the south of Edinburgh which can be easily accessed by the Borders Railway (approx 25 mins) or by bus/car along the bypass which also leads to the south via the A1, the international airport, and the central belt motorway network. Locally the town has a selection of specialist shops plus there is a Tesco superstore in nearby Eskbank. Further amenities can be found at Dalkeith's High Street which is nearby. Leisure activities in the vicinity include a sports/recreation centre, swimming pool, Newtongrange Public Park, and vast expanses of open countryside along with Dalkeith country park and Go Ape. Schooling is well represented from nursery to senior level with a primary school only a five-minute walk away.
